COFCAWE exists to empower children, women and their families in health, social and livelihood skills. COFCAWE works to educate rural communities on issues such as sexual and reproductive health, and gender relations. They also work with teenage mothers, helping them acquire vital livelihood skills including tailoring and hairdressing so that they can start small businesses to provide for themselves and their children.
